/******************************************************************************
$Log$
Revision 2.8 1997/09/03 18:19:38 guido
#Plug small memory leaks in constructors.
Revision 2.7 1997/09/03 00:09:26 guido
Fix the bug Jeremy was experiencing: both the close() and the
dealloc() functions contained code to free/DECREF the buffer
(there were differences between I and O objects but the logic bug was
the same). Fixed this be setting the buffer pointer to NULL and
testing for that. (This also makes it safe to call close() more than
once.)
XXX Worry: what if you try to read() or write() once the thing is
closed?
Revision 2.6 1997/08/13 03:14:41 guido
cPickle release 0.3 from Jim Fulton
Revision 1.21 1997/06/19 18:51:42 jim
Added ident string.
Revision 1.20 1997/06/13 20:50:50 jim
- Various changes to make gcc -Wall -pedantic happy, including
getting rid of staticforward declarations and adding pretend use
of two statics defined in .h file.
Revision 1.19 1997/06/02 18:15:17 jim
Merged in guido's changes.
Revision 1.18 1997/05/07 16:26:47 jim
getvalue() can nor be given an argument. If this argument is true,
then getvalue returns the text upto the current position. Otherwise
it returns all of the text. The default value of the argument is
false.
Revision 1.17 1997/04/17 18:02:46 chris
getvalue() now returns entire string, not just the string up to
current position
Revision 2.5 1997/04/11 19:56:06 guido
My own patch: support writable 'softspace' attribute.
> Jim asked: What is softspace for?
It's an old feature. The print statement uses this to remember
whether it should insert a space before the next item or not.
Implementation is in fileobject.c.
Revision 1.11 1997/01/23 20:45:01 jim
ANSIfied it.
Changed way C API was exported.
Revision 1.10 1997/01/02 15:19:55 chris
checked in to be sure repository is up to date.
Revision 1.9 1996/12/27 21:40:29 jim
Took out some lamosities in interface, like returning self from
write.
Revision 1.8 1996/12/23 15:52:49 jim
Added ifdef to check for CObject before using it.
Revision 1.7 1996/12/23 15:22:35 jim
Finished implementation, adding full compatibility with StringIO, and
then some.
*****************************************************************************/
